深度探索DeepSeek智能对话系统的安装与配置

《深度探索DeepSeek智能对话系统的安装与配置》

在这个数字化时代,智能对话系统已经成为企业、机构和个人不可或缺的工具。DeepSeek智能对话系统,作为一款功能强大、易于扩展的智能对话解决方案,受到了广泛关注。本文将带领大家深入了解DeepSeek智能对话系统的安装与配置过程,让你轻松上手,开启智能对话的新篇章。

一、DeepSeek智能对话系统的概述

DeepSeek智能对话系统是一款基于深度学习技术的智能对话系统,它能够实现自然语言理解、语义分析、对话生成等功能。该系统采用模块化设计,易于扩展和定制,适用于各种场景,如客服、智能助手、聊天机器人等。

二、DeepSeek智能对话系统的安装

  1. 环境准备

在安装DeepSeek智能对话系统之前,需要确保以下环境满足要求:

(1)操作系统:Linux或Windows

(2)Python版本:Python 3.6及以上

(3)Python依赖库:numpy、pandas、scikit-learn、tensorflow等


  1. 安装步骤

(1)克隆DeepSeek智能对话系统的代码库

git clone https://github.com/your-repository/deepseek.git
cd deepseek

(2)安装依赖库

pip install -r requirements.txt

(3)编译模型

python setup.py build

(4)安装DeepSeek智能对话系统

pip install .

三、DeepSeek智能对话系统的配置

  1. 配置文件介绍

DeepSeek智能对话系统的配置文件主要包括以下几个部分:

(1)对话管理器配置

对话管理器负责处理对话流程,包括对话状态、意图识别、槽位填充等。配置文件中需要定义对话管理器类、状态转移规则、意图识别模型等。

(2)意图识别配置

意图识别模块负责识别用户输入的意图。配置文件中需要定义意图识别模型、词汇表、词性标注等。

(3)槽位填充配置

槽位填充模块负责填充对话中的槽位信息。配置文件中需要定义槽位填充模型、词汇表、词性标注等。


  1. 配置步骤

(1)修改配置文件

根据实际需求,修改对话管理器、意图识别和槽位填充等模块的配置文件。

(2)加载配置文件

from deepseek.config import Config
config = Config()

(3)初始化模块

from deepseek.dialogue_manager import DialogueManager
from deepseek.intent_recognition import IntentRecognition
from deepseek.slot_filling import SlotFilling

dialogue_manager = DialogueManager(config)
intent_recognition = IntentRecognition(config)
slot_filling = SlotFilling(config)

四、DeepSeek智能对话系统的测试与优化

  1. 测试

在测试阶段,可以使用以下方法验证DeepSeek智能对话系统的性能:

(1)使用测试数据集进行测试

test_data = [...]  # 测试数据集
for data in test_data:
dialogue_manager.process(data)

(2)观察对话日志,分析对话流程


  1. 优化

根据测试结果,对DeepSeek智能对话系统进行以下优化:

(1)调整对话管理器配置,优化对话流程

(2)优化意图识别和槽位填充模型,提高识别准确率

(3)扩展词汇表,增加对话场景

五、总结

本文详细介绍了DeepSeek智能对话系统的安装与配置过程。通过阅读本文,读者可以轻松上手,构建自己的智能对话系统。在实际应用中,不断优化和调整系统配置,提高对话质量,为用户提供更好的服务。

猜你喜欢:聊天机器人开发